
Leo Varmak worked on enhancing WebView compatibility for iOS 26 in the mobile-dev-inc/maestro repository, focusing on integrating the SafariViewService hierarchy to improve element access and reliability. He modernized the testing framework by updating end-to-end tests and rebuilding iOS test runners to align with the latest iOS and macOS runtimes. Using Swift, Shell, and YAML, Leo expanded test coverage for web views and ensured the CI environment supported upcoming platform releases. His work addressed compatibility issues and streamlined the testing process, demonstrating depth in continuous integration and iOS development while delivering a targeted feature within a focused timeframe.
